What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Boston to Seoul Incheon Airport?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Boston to Incheon Intl Airport cl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

For Boston to Seoul Incheon Airport, Monday is the cheapest day to fly on average and Friday is the most expensive. Flying from Seoul Incheon Airport back to Boston, the best deals are generally found on Tuesday, with Friday being the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Boston to Incheon Intl Airport?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Boston to Incheon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Boston to Incheon Intl Airport is September, where tickets cost $979 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and June,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$2,045 and $2,009 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Boston to Incheon Intl Airport?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Boston to Incheon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Boston to Incheon Intl Airport, you should book around 2 weeks before departure, which saves you about 18%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 13 weeks before departure.

FAQs for booking Boston to Seoul Incheon Airport flights

  • Which airline among those flying to Incheon offers the baggage allowance?

    Air Canada is one of the airlines that flies to Incheon from Boston that has Baggage allowances offered to its passengers. Those travelers coming on board are required to have one standard article and one personal article for their journey for free without any charges. All your articles should fit in the cabin.

  • Which airline is suitable to book when flying from Boston to Incheon with kid(s)?

    If you are flying from Boston to Incheon in the company of your child, you are supposed to book an airline that is kid-friendly. Turkish Airlines allows kids to fly on it with a discounted child ticket if your kid is between 2 to 12 years. Infants are allowed to travel on the lap of their accompanied adult.

  • How can I easily get out of Incheon International Airport (ICN)?

    Upon your landing at ICN Airport, there are a variety of transport options you can use to get you out of the airport to your destination. This includes taking of the Airport Railroad Express, Seoul Metropolitan Subway, Airport Limousine Buses, and Taxis. You only have to choose which option will suit your interest.

  • Which airline offers wheelchair services to the reduced mobility travelers flying to Incheon?

    For disabled travelers flying from Boston to Incheon, booking Etihad Airways will help them benefit from the wheelchair services offered with their flights. They will experience the services when they communicate their disability during reservation so as to get special treatment with the staff on board who are always ready and willing to offer assistance.

  • What is the cheapest flight from Boston to Incheon Intl Airport?

    In the last 3 days, the lowest price for a flight from Boston to Incheon Intl Airport was $413 for a one-way ticket and $831 for a round-trip.

  • Do I need a passport to fly between Boston and Seoul Incheon Airport?

    Yes, you’ll need a passport to travel to Seoul Incheon Airport from Boston.

  • Which airlines offer Wi-Fi service onboard planes from Boston to Seoul Incheon Airport?

    Only Asiana Airlines offers inflight Wi-Fi service on the Boston to Seoul Incheon Airport flight route.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Boston to Seoul Incheon Airport?

    The Boeing 777-300ER is the aircraft model that flies most regularly on the Boston to Seoul Incheon Airport flight route.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Boston to Seoul Incheon Airport?

    oneworld, Star Alliance, and SkyTeam are the airline alliances operating flights between Boston and Seoul Incheon Airport, with oneworld being the most commonly used for this route.

  • On which days can I fly direct from Boston to Seoul Incheon Airport?

    There are nonstop flights from Boston to Seoul Incheon Airport on a daily basis.

  • Which is the best airline for flights from Boston to Incheon, Korean Air or Delta?

    The two airlines most popular with KAYAK users for flights from Boston to Incheon are Korean Air and Delta. With an average price for the route of $1,988 and an overall rating of 8.4, Korean Air is the most popular choice. Delta is also a great choice for the route, with an average price of $1,924 and an overall rating of 7.9.

KAYAK’s top tips for finding a cheap flight from Boston to Incheon Intl Airport

  • Looking for a cheap flight? 25% of our users found flights on this route for $567 or less one-way and $882 or less round-trip.
  • Most of the flights leaving Boston City depart from Boston Logan International Airport (BOS) and land in Incheon City through the Incheon International Airport (ICN). Other than this route, you can also consider flying from Worcester Regional Airport (ORH) to Gimpo International Airport (GMP) serving as your departure and arrival airports respectively.
  • Booking Delta Air Lines for your flight from Boston to Incheon will make you benefit from the daily flights flying from Boston to Incheon. This is because this airline serves as a hub of Boston Logan International Airport (BOS). The daily frequent flights will help you in booking a flight that suits your daily schedule.
  • When you are planning to book your flights from Boston to Incheon, you will decide whether you will have to fly direct or choose the route that will allow you to stop along your journey before reaching your destination. Booking with United Airlines will allow you to stop at Denver International Airport (DEN) and San Francisco International Airport (SFO). The two airports serve as the layover airports for the flights from BOS to ICN.
  • Lufthansa Airlines is one of the airlines flying from Boston to Incheon that offers special diets to its passengers when requested. For those travelers who have special dietary requirements that have to be met, booking this airline will be of more benefit to them. You are only required to order your special meal when booking your flight.
  • If you are in Downtown Boston and you want to connect to BOS airport, you should consider using the Silver Line Rapid Transit buses as means of your transport. The buses operate the whole week between Downtown Boston and the airport. You can also use taxis when in a hurry for they offer the quickest transportation to the airport.
